Transaction 85a7d882333734fbe1682a1b51ac24b0d37fd1e2f207f83f2ff71dca68fed8c9

1 Input
1 Outputs
  • 85a7d882333734fbe1682a1b51ac24b0d37fd1e2f207f83f2ff71dca68fed8c9:0
  • value  139661614
    address  3BMEXH49AEQGHhXXLGkdmfPKE2MW2uDA2p